The national teams of England and Serbia are scheduled to play against each other on Thursday, 13 November as part of the match day 9 out of 10 of the FIFA World Cup 2026 qualifiers. The game will take place at the Wembley Stadium in London. The kick off time is 7:45 pm GMT. You can follow the game on ITV1, STV, ITVX, and STV Player.

Their first meeting in this format took place on 9 September. The hosting Serbia lost 0 – 5. As of now, England has played 6 out of the scheduled 10 matches within its group. They won all six, and now top the group table, qualifying to advance to the 2026 FIFA World Cup. Serbia has won 3 games, lost 2, and ended 1 in a draw. They occupy the third place in the group table and are currently one point below Albania, competing for the chance to qualify for the play offs.

Handicap Betting Odds

While some bets are easy to understand and suitable for newcomers in the world of sports betting, handicap bets belong to the advanced category. Punters are often recommended to get some exposure to the betting mechanisms and gain deep knowledge of their favourite sport before venturing into handicap betting.

The aim of the handicap bets is to balance out the unpredictability factor in matches where the power is distributed unevenly and one of the teams has a clear advantage to win. Under handicap bets, the win has to be achieved while observing certain conditions imposed by the bet.

The most popular handicap bet in football is the goal difference, however you will find a wide range of other bets to choose from.

Here is how the goal difference bet works. Let’s say, you bet that Team A, which is considered the favourite of the match, will win with a -1.5 goal difference. In this case your wager will only qualify for a payout if by the end of the game Team A’s score is higher by at least two goals. If the difference is lower, you will lose your stake.

Scores like 2 – 0, 3 – 1, or 4 – 1 will all work in your favour. But keep in mind that predicting the actual final score isn’t required of you.

This is one of the rare bets that allows you to bet on the losing team too. For example, you may bet that the underdog Team B will lose with a +2 goal difference. This means they can’t lose by more than one goal (for example, 0 – 1, 2 – 3 or similar). If the goal difference is higher, your wager will lose.

Goal Total (Over/Under) Odds

Similarly to the previous bet, this one isn’t based on the main outcome of the game. Instead, you’re trying to predict whether the total amount of all goals scored in the game will be more (over) or less (under) than a certain number specified by the bookmaker in the offer.

This doesn’t mean that you have to predict the exact final score. Here is how this bet works. If you bet that the goal total of the match will be over 2.5 goals, it means that for your wager to win, the sum of all goals scored by both teams should amount to 3 or more goals (for example, 2 – 1, 0 – 3, or 2 – 2). If the match ends with a lower goal total (let’s say, 2 – 0, goal total 2), you will lose your wager.
